convert_documentA

Convert markdown to a professionally formatted document using an MDMagic template.

IMPORTANT GUIDANCE:

  1. Output format → what user gets:

    • 'docx' → a single Word .docx file

    • 'pdf' → a single .pdf file

    • 'html' → a single .html file

    • 'all' → a ZIP containing all three (DOCX + PDF + HTML)

  2. If the user is ambiguous (e.g. 'convert this'), ASK which format they want before calling. Don't assume.

  3. Filename: if the user attached a file (e.g. 'mydoc.md'), pass its base name as fileName. Otherwise the API derives one from the markdown's first H1. Without either, downloads end up with timestamped names like 'content-1778298071915.docx' which is bad UX.

  4. On 'template not found' errors: call list_all_templates first, show available options, let the user pick. Do NOT fall back to generating documents with code execution — that produces inferior results that don't use the user's actual MDMagic templates.

  5. The response includes structured fields (downloadUrl, creditsUsed, balanceAfter, fileName, expiresAt) — surface these to the user explicitly. Don't paraphrase. The user wants to know exactly what they spent and what's left.

  6. Page sizes: A3, A4, Executive, US_Legal, US_Letter. Default A4. Orientation: Portrait or Landscape, default Portrait.

list_all_templatesA

List all 15 built-in MDMagic templates plus any custom templates the user has uploaded.

CALL THIS PROACTIVELY when:

  • The user mentions a template by name (verify it exists before convert_document)

  • The user asks 'what templates are available' or similar

  • A previous convert_document call returned 'template not found'

  • The user describes the look they want without naming a template (so you can suggest a real one)

Returns: name, description, type (built-in vs custom), and category. Categories are: Business (5 templates), Creative (6), Professional (2), Technical (2). Use the optional category filter to narrow recommendations (e.g. 'for legal documents' → category: 'Professional').

list_builtin_templatesA

List the 15 built-in MDMagic templates, grouped by category. Same as list_all_templates but excludes the user's custom uploads. Use this when the user asks specifically about MDMagic's bundled templates rather than their personal ones.

Categories available: Business (5), Creative (6), Professional (2), Technical (2).

list_custom_templatesA

List only the user's custom-uploaded Word templates. Use this when the user asks about their own templates ('show me my templates', 'do I have a letterhead?'). Custom templates are referenced by UUID, not name, when calling convert_document.

show_default_settingsA

Show the user's default paper size and orientation preferences (set on their account page). Useful when the user hasn't specified pageSize/orientation explicitly — call this to honor their defaults instead of using A4/Portrait blindly.

check_credit_balanceA

Check the user's current MDMagic credit balance: subscription credits (renewable monthly), purchased credits (permanent), plan name, and plan status.

CALL THIS PROACTIVELY when:

  • The user asks 'how many credits do I have' or similar

  • After a conversion, if the user wants to know what's left (also returned by convert_document directly)

  • Before a conversion of an unusually large document, to warn the user if balance is borderline

estimate_conversion_costA

Estimate credit cost for a conversion BEFORE running it. Returns word count, page calculation (300 words/page), and a credit breakdown by format and template type. Use this when the user asks 'how much will this cost?' or when you suspect a conversion might exceed their balance — convert_document refuses to run if credits are insufficient, so estimating first is friendlier.

validate_markdownA

Pre-flight markdown validation BEFORE conversion. Catches malformed tables (mismatched pipes), unclosed code fences, broken task lists, and unsupported syntax. Returns a green/amber/red status plus the detected markdown features.

CALL THIS PROACTIVELY when:

  • The user is about to convert a long document (>5 pages) — validating first is cheap; running a doomed conversion costs credits

  • The user reports a previous conversion produced broken output

  • You generated the markdown yourself and want to verify it's clean before spending credits

Returns: status (green=safe, amber=minor issues, red=will likely break), detected features (tables, code blocks, task lists, math), and a human-readable message.

get_template_detailsA

Show available variants (page sizes and orientations) for a specific template. All MDMagic templates support the full 5×2 matrix: A3, A4, Executive, US_Legal, US_Letter × Portrait/Landscape. Use this when the user asks 'does this template come in Legal Landscape?' or 'what sizes are available?' — confirms the variant before convert_document runs.

recommend_templateA

Suggest the best built-in template(s) for a described purpose. Use this when the user describes WHAT the document is (e.g. 'Q4 board pack', 'API reference', 'wedding invitation', 'legal contract') without naming a template. Returns ranked recommendations with rationale.

Why this exists: AI assistants often guess template names that don't exist. This tool maps purpose → real template names from MDMagic's catalog, so convert_document doesn't fail with 'template not found'.
